Scholardle

Scholardle, also known as academic Wordle, is a clever twist on the popular word game Wordle. While Wordle challenges players to guess a five-letter word in six attempts, Scholardle ups the ante by requiring players to guess a five-letter academic word within the same limit. The game retains the core mechanics of Wordle but adds an academic twist, making it a stimulating challenge for those who enjoy word games and want to test their knowledge of academic vocabulary.

How to play Scholardle

Playing Scholardle is straightforward yet intellectually stimulating. Here's a step-by-step guide on how to play:

  1. Guess the Academic Word: The objective of Scholardle is to guess a five-letter academic word within six attempts.

  2. Receive Feedback: After each guess, the game provides feedback in three colors:

    • Green: Indicates that a letter is in the word and the correct position.
    • Yellow: Signifies that a letter is in the word but in the wrong position.
    • Grey: Denotes that a letter is not in the word at all.
  3. Refine Your Guesses: Use the feedback provided to refine your subsequent guesses, strategically narrowing down the possibilities until you correctly identify the academic word.

  4. Winning the Game: Successfully guess the academic word within six attempts to win the game.

Tips and Tactics for Scholardle

To excel at Scholardle, consider implementing the following tips and tactics:

Familiarize Yourself with Academic Vocabulary

Since Scholardle revolves around academic words, familiarizing yourself with academic vocabulary will significantly enhance your gameplay. Consider studying common academic terms across various disciplines to broaden your word pool.

Strategic Guessing

Approach each guess strategically, considering both the letters themselves and their potential positions within the word. Use the feedback provided after each guess to adjust your strategy accordingly.

Process of Elimination

Employ a process of elimination to narrow down the possible words with each guess. Eliminate letters and word combinations based on the feedback received to progressively zero in on the correct answer.

Practice Regularly

To get better at any game, practice is essential. Dedicate time to playing Scholardle regularly to sharpen your word-guessing abilities and expand your academic vocabulary.
